Decoder Error - The video decoder has either malfunctioned or is not installed.

A fresh install of Microsoft Media Center Edition 2005 may not have the necessary CODEC,as a result when you are trying to view Live TV then the Television won't display correctly and you will get the following error:-Decoder Error - The video decoder has either malfunctioned or is not installed.

Resolution:-

1]Download the Microsoft Windows XP Video Decoder Checkup Utility .This utility will help you to determine if an MPEG-2 video decoder or, a DVD decoder is installed on your system and whether or not the decoder is compatible with Windows Media Player 10 and Windows XP Media Center Edition 2005.

2] Next you download and install compatible video decoder which will allow you to view TV without any prroblem.Nvidia,Cyberlink Power DVD,Win DVD or,Sonic will help.Personally I find Nvidia Pure Video is excellent.Remember you just need the decoder not the full or entire package.
